In Los Angeles, California, a brave woman went to extreme lengths to rescue her cherished French bulldog from a thief.
On January 18, an incident took place outside a Whole Foods supermarket where a lady approached Ali Zacharias, the owner of a dog, and abruptly took her pet away.
The woman transported the dog, who goes by the name Onyx, to a white car being operated by another individual.
Bravely, Zacharias was determined not to allow the thieves to escape after taking Onyx. He leaped onto the front of the car and held on tightly as it raced down a crowded street in Los Angeles.

Zacharias recounted how he firmly decided not to release his grip on the car and clung onto the windshield wipers. He found himself startled as the car continued driving down the street and accelerating, causing him to panic and fear for his safety. This account was shared by Zacharias with CBS News.
The incident was captured on video and has since become widely shared, featuring Zacharias clinging onto the car's hood.
Zacharias recounted the incident to NBC News via a TikTok video, explaining that when he tugged on the leash, she initially thought he wanted to go sniff something, so she let go. However, to her surprise, she looked up and saw a woman holding her dog and walking away with him. Determined to retrieve her dog, Zacharias positioned herself in front of the car and firmly stated that they could not leave because they had her dog. Instead of stopping, the individuals driving the car continued to move forward, even driving into her until she fell onto the hood of the car. Despite this, Zacharias remained determined and declared that she would not leave until her dog was returned to her. However, the individuals in the car ignored her plea and continued to drive away.
Regrettably, Zacharias' brave attempts to save her cute dog were not successful. She managed to hold on for a short distance before the vehicle suddenly changed direction, causing her to be thrown off and resulting in minor injuries like cuts and bruises. Sadly, Onyx is still nowhere to be found.
"I feel a sense of sadness whenever I engage in any activity, as I wish I could involve Onyx or that he could experience it too. For instance, when I go grocery shopping, I can't help but think that I'm not purchasing anything for him. It's surprising how swiftly time has passed, as it feels like this situation just occurred. However, it's already been 10 days," she expressed.
As reported by CBS, the Los Angeles Police Department is currently engaged in an ongoing investigation into the crime, which involves the thorough examination of security camera footage
